It was in the 1994 biopic Ed Wood (1994) that Bela Lugosi (played by Martin Landau) got upset when a stagehand who, after asking for an autograph, complimented Mr Lugosi's performance as "Karloff's sidekick" in The Invisible Ray. Lugosi (Landau) unleashed quite a string of expletives, and the poor stagehand never got the autograph. I cannot recall the name of the stagehand.

Ed Wood was directed by Tim Burton and starred Johnny Depp as bargain budget filmmaker Ed Wood, best known for Plan 9 from Outer Space (1959).

I have been a fan of Ed Wood since its release. While it may not be completely accurate, the film is still a wonderfully nostalgic look at the seedier side of 1950s Hollywood, and the friendship that developed between Ed Wood and Bela Lugosi. Johnny Depp and Martin Landau are both superb in their respective roles.

I didn't know, or had forgotten, that the stagehand character who set Lugosi off was Conrad Brooks. The real Conrad Brooks appeared in a number of Ed Wood movies, including Glen or Glenda, Bride of the Monster and Plan 9 from Outer Space. He is still around today.
